Heat capacity Definition, Units, & Facts Britannica

Heat capacity or thermal capacity is a physical property of matter, defined as the amount of heat to be supplied to an object to produce a unit change in its temperature. The SI unit of heat capacity is joule per kelvin (J/K). Heat capacity is an extensive property. WebHeat capacity, also known as thermal capacity, is a physical property of matter defined as the amount of heat needed to cause a unit change in temperature in a given mass of material. The molar heat capacity is determined by dividing the heat capacity by the sum of substances in moles.
